Puiyin Wong is the Innovation & Scholarship Manager, a member of the Innovation, Learning & Scholarship Team. She is responsible for the development and enhancement of Educational Scholarship across QMUL. This includes supporting colleagues in developing their practice, managing projects, and running workshops related to Educational Scholarship. 

 With a background in creative arts and digital education in HE, Puiyin oversaw the curriculum development of online and low residency courses at Central Saint Martins (UAL). Previous to that, Puiyin co-led the strategic implementation and provision of digital education at the Royal College of Art.  

Puiyin is active in the HE and digital education community; she serves as a Trustee of ALT (Association for Learning Technology) and as the Vice-Chair of the ALT M25-LTG Special Interest Group. With a specialism in community building and practice sharing, Puiyin runs a number of popular projects, these include: 

#TELresearchers & #HEresearchers webinar series, where established educational researchers share with us their scholarly practice: https://telresearchers.substack.com/ 

My Liminal Pod is a podcast where Puiyin talks to her peers about interests and issues in HE and digital education: https://podcasters.spotify.com/pod/show/puiyin-wong 

Research

Research Interests:

Puiyin is a PhD candidate in the Educational Research Department at Lancaster University, where she is also the Doctoral Researchers Representative at the Centre for Technology Enhanced Learning. Her thesis explores the potential benefits to professional development in creating educational podcasts, for the podcasters themselves.  

More broadly speaking, Puiyin’s research interests include how technology can develop learning networks, subsequently how learners can benefit from the dissemination of knowledge in these networks freely and openly. She is particularly partial to anything Threshold Concepts and the Networked Learning Theory.
